"""Unit tests for the shared chat-image capability resolver. Two resolvers, two intents: - ``derive_supports_image_input`` — best-effort True for the catalog and selector. Default-allow on unknown / unmapped models. The streaming task safety net never sees this value directly. - ``is_known_text_only_chat_model`` — strict opt-out for the safety net. Returns True only when LiteLLM's model map *explicitly* sets ``supports_vision=False``. Anything else (missing key, exception, True) returns False so the request flows through to the provider.
